Assessment of movement skills and concepts is a vital part of the teaching process in PE, far more than a report grade.
Through assessment, we learn how students are progressing with skill development and movement understanding, and adjust PE programs accordingly. But assessment can be difficult and teachers often ask:
- How do I fit assessment into lessons?
- How can I assess all students fairly?
- Are grades allocated to students truly reflective of their capabilities?
Reimagining Assessment in PE explores how to use observation, questioning and feedback techniques as the basis for your assessment program. Assess as you teach – creating efficiency and authenticity.
Co-designed by practicing PDHPE teachers and experts in physical education pedagogy, the workshop is evidence-based and informed by real-school experience.
The day covers five key sessions:
- Understanding assessment
- Unpacking the standards for movement performance
- Observation and feedback: tools for efficient assessment
- The power of questioning to check, progress and assess understanding
- Bringing it all together: Identifying and recording evidence of learning.
